The Problem

Creator search behavior is completely misunderstood

Most platforms optimize for generic keywords like 'creator platform' or 'influencer marketing' when creators actually search for specific use cases, problems, and comparisons. They search for 'how to monetize YouTube channel', 'best platform for course creators', or 'OnlyFans vs Patreon for podcasters'. Missing these intent-driven searches means losing qualified creator signups to competitors who understand actual search behavior.

Audience search intent is completely ignored

Creator economy businesses focus only on creator acquisition but ignore the millions of searches from audiences looking for creators to follow, content to consume, or platforms to discover new talent. Searches like 'best fitness creators on Instagram' or 'top business podcasts' represent massive traffic opportunities that most platforms never capture. This dual-sided SEO opportunity is entirely wasted.

Technical SEO breaks under creator-generated content

Creator platforms generate massive amounts of dynamic content that search engines struggle to index properly. User-generated profiles, course pages, and creator portfolios often have duplicate content issues, poor URL structures, or missing metadata. The result is thousands of pages that could drive organic traffic but remain invisible to search engines, creating a massive missed opportunity.

Local search optimization is completely overlooked

Many creators serve local markets — fitness trainers, photographers, event planners, consultants — but platforms ignore local SEO entirely. Creators can't be discovered for location-based searches, missing out on hyper-targeted audiences in their geographic area. This is especially damaging for service-based creators who rely on local client acquisition but can't leverage their platform for local discovery.

How We Help

We begin with a comprehensive analysis of both creator and audience search behavior specific to your platform niche. This involves keyword research that goes beyond traditional tools, diving into creator communities, forums, and social platforms to understand actual search intent. We map the complete search journey from discovery to platform signup, identifying content gaps that your competitors are missing.

Our strategy development creates dual-sided SEO approaches that capture both creator acquisition and audience discovery opportunities. We design content architectures that showcase creator profiles, courses, and portfolios while building topical authority in your vertical. The key is understanding that creator platforms need to rank for both 'how to become a creator' searches and 'find creators in X niche' searches simultaneously.

Technical implementation focuses on solving the unique challenges of creator-generated content. We implement dynamic SEO systems that automatically optimize creator profiles, course pages, and portfolio content for search discovery. This includes structured data markup for creator profiles, automated metadata generation, and URL optimization strategies that scale with platform growth.

Local SEO optimization helps creators capture geographic search traffic in their markets. We implement location-based optimization for creator profiles, build local content strategies, and create systems for creators to be discovered in their cities and regions. This is especially powerful for service-based creators who can dramatically expand their reach through local search visibility.
